After Eighteen Months of Work, the Parish Center Gives Way to the Maison Saint John Paul II in Sanary

Summary by varmatin.com
It took eighteen months of work to transform the former Saint Vincent Parish Centre into the renovated and enlarged Saint John Paul II Parish House, inaugurated on Sunday during an ecumenical ceremony that brought together the parish priest of Sanary Gabriel Dabezis, the vicar Richard Quiro
